West Forest Capital recently closed a $3.2 million asset-based bridge loan after a matured Hamptons mortgage entered default and conventional lenders declined to refinance a luxury Quogue property. The deal was closed within 10 days.
Despite the borrower’s urgent timing constraints, the asset retained substantial equity and an estimated as-is valuation of approximately $6.6 million, creating a viable path for structured short-term financing. West Forest Capital structured the bridge loan around the strength of the collateral, the borrower’s equity position, and a defined path toward repayment, stabilization, and a potential market sale.
That structure immediately reduced refinancing pressure during a critical stage of the transaction while preserving the borrower’s flexibility. Instead of forcing a distressed sale or deeper financial pressure, the 12-month interest-only asset-based Long Island bridge loan created additional time to complete remaining property improvements and pursue either a long-term refinance or a market sale under more favorable conditions.
After the original loan matured and entered default, many traditional lenders declined to refinance despite the property’s strong value and clear exit strategy. West Forest Capital evaluated the real estate fundamentals and repayment plan instead of relying solely on conventional bank underwriting standards.
“Traditional lenders often cannot move forward once a loan has matured or entered default, even when the underlying real estate is strong,” said Minsok Oh, Founding Principal of West Forest Capital. “This is exactly where West Forest Capital can provide value. We were able to evaluate the collateral, understand the business plan, and deliver a practical short-term bridge financing solution for a time-sensitive situation.”
Transactions involving transitional assets, incomplete projects, urgent refinance deadlines, or maturity defaults often require bridge loan decisions within days instead of months.
